"Now, not being organized is basically disorganization, right? Well let me tell you what can happen if your messages, your presentation, so forth, are not organized. Disorganization can lead to confusion and misinterpretation. Oh I didn't really follow that, oh I thought you were talking about this or that. And what can happen as a result of that is bad business decisions can be made because the information was not necessarily presented clearly or in an organized manner. And if bad business decisions are made sometimes business relationships can be destroyed, or deteriorate, or bottom line you might just lose some business. So see it's kind of a domino effect, you really need to take the time on the front end to organize your message so that it's easy for everything else down the line to fall into place."
